Told in multiple POVs in both the present and past, Twenty-Seven Minutes relies heavily on the characters’ mental health issues to create unreliable narrators and further the suspense of what happened a decade ago. I am always wary of books that use this device in mysteries and unfortunately it didn’t work for me here. I would have liked to see the mystery of the night Phoebe died be shrouded by something other than someone’s deteriorating mental health, especially given that it seems everyone in town believed what was originally told to police on that night so there was no real need to tell this story.

Not for me. Really slow. I got 50% through and did not care for the characters and decided to check out the reviews. The low reviews had a lot of complaints similar to mine. The story doesn’t feel like an unfurling mystery, it just feels like it is dancing around getting to the point for the sake of trying to create a mystery. The twist really wasn’t that rewarding. The jumps back & forth through time did not flow well for me.
